Discovering the Best Psychotherapist Near Me

Finding the ideal therapist is a crucial primary step to much better mental health. There are numerous aspects to think about, including their credentials and experience.

Consideration should likewise be given to the therapeutic alliance. If the connection isn't there, even if their professional accreditations look great, discover another person. Preferably book 3 consultation calls and choose the one that feels most like a fit.
Ask for Referrals

Whether you're searching for a psychotherapist in NYC or any other location, referrals from family and friends are one of the very best ways to find someone. These individuals can assist you narrow down your options by thinking about useful matters like licensure, insurance protection, and area. They can likewise provide you a feel for the therapist's design and method. They can even share their own experiences with a particular therapist or help you understand what to expect from therapy.

In addition, your physician might be able to recommend a therapist who is right for you. Numerous doctors and healthcare professionals have actually dealt with a wide range of customers, and they can offer a wealth of insight. They can even make particular suggestions based upon your needs, such as gender or age.

Another fantastic source of referrals is from coworkers at work. They can give you referrals for therapists they have actually dealt with and trust. They can also help you comprehend what to try to find in a therapist, such as their theoretical orientation and whether they concentrate on individual or group therapy.

You can likewise ask for recommendations from other members of your community, such as religious leaders or school teachers. You can likewise browse online for a therapist utilizing websites such as Psychology Today. These websites allow you to filter your search based upon factors such as location, insurance coverage, and specialties. You can also check out evaluations from previous patients, which can be helpful in figuring out whether a therapist is ideal for you.

Browse Online

While it's practical to get a recommendation from somebody you trust, lots of people likewise use online tools and online search engine to discover therapists near them. Lots of websites have directories of psychological health companies, allowing you to narrow your choices by location, specialized, insurance and more. These resources can be particularly helpful when you're new to the area and don't have a personal connection to anyone who might refer you.



You can also attempt browsing for a psychotherapist near you by name or the kind of treatment you desire, such as household or individual treatment. You can even find therapists who concentrate on certain medical diagnoses, such as depression or anxiety. This can assist you focus your search and make sure that you're getting the best treatment for the specific problem you have.

Some online searches will offer you with a list of local therapists, while others might use a more sophisticated search that can match you with therapists who have experience with your particular requirements or issues. You can even find therapists who can provide teletherapy, which can be a convenient choice when you live far away from the workplace or have trouble traveling.

When you've compiled a list of prospective therapists, it's an excellent idea to arrange an initial assessment with every one. This is normally a short and totally free session that permits you to ask questions and see whether the therapist is an excellent fit for you.

Throughout this first session, make sure to ask the therapist for how long they have actually been licensed and in practice, as well as what their specializeds are. You can likewise ask about their method to treatment, what sort of training they have actually gotten and whether or not they are comfortable working with the kind of issues you're dealing with.

You can also check out a therapist's site or social media to get more information about them and what they may be like in session. In addition, you can look at online reviews from previous customers. Try To Find Online Therapy

Finding a therapist can be like apartment-hunting in a busy market, and it may take some time to find one you trust and work well with. If you're able to get personal referrals, that can help. However if you can't, don't stress-- there are a lot of choices out there. You can utilize sites that provide a searchable database of psychologists or counselors by location and specialized, and you can even search for therapists that offer telehealth services (video therapy).

Once you've narrowed down your list of prospective therapists, it's important to talk on the phone. Ask about their schedule, charge structure and cancellation policy, whether they accept insurance, and if they have any experience working with your specific issues. You can also discover out if they use "evidence-based treatment," which are tested strategies for handling concerns such as depression, anxiety, sleep issues and bedwetting in children.

If you have medical insurance, it's helpful to discover out if your therapist has been on the panel of providers for your prepare for a long time. This can provide you self-confidence that they have actually been reviewed by the insurance provider for their proficiency and quality of care, and that you will have the ability to get treatment at an affordable expense.

You can also ask your therapist for referrals from previous clients or colleagues and call them to get an idea of how the therapist interacts with individuals during sessions. This can offer you a sense of how comfy you will be sharing your feelings in their presence and their technique to counseling.

Lastly, you should consider any cultural or gender preferences that relate to your psychological health needs. Some people feel more at ease with a therapist that shares their racial or ethnic background, or understands their sexual preference and/or choice, as these can make it much easier to form a healing alliance. This is why some websites, such as BetterHelp, include the ability to search for therapists by these elements of identity.

You need to also pay attention to how you feel throughout the call, and if you do not delight in speaking to your therapist or discover their approach to therapy inappropriate, carry on. It's essential to establish a great connection with your therapist so you can open up about your sensations and discuss them in a safe environment.
